- Shari -
It proceeds like in a rush.
The innkeeper fast confirms the corpses in our room on the second floor and is taking then a big bell and rings it loudly.
Soon I see some of the other residents stumble out of their rooms.
While this establishment is surely not high-class, there is a good number of rooms.
I think I counted five doors on the second floor and maybe two rooms on the ground level, yet I haven’t looked too close.
At least eight persons are gathering at the counter.
"Sorry to tell you that, but someone couldn’t play by the rules and so we have two corpses here. You know the drill. I have to call the guard, so you have at most one hour before they are coming. Whatever it is that you have, I don’t want to know. So just be done by then!" (innkeeper)
In a flash, most of the residents vanish from their position and enter their rooms instantly. I notice quite some rumbling inside.
Only two have a calm demeanor.
Some old man, with grey-white hair and beard, who all my prejudices tell me is a mage, and a cloaked figure, which is serenely heading back into the room it occupied.
The second one is surprising as I was sure this one actually looks suspicious and has something to hide.
Soon most of the residents are leaving with obvious bulges under their clothes, heavy bags, or sacs.
As for me, I get a little bit anxious about a body examination.
That wouldn’t end well for everyone.
And for sure I cannot just leave, as it was my doing.
After it has settled a bit the innkeeper turns to us.
"So! Has one of you the kindness to tell me why Rick and Gordo are lying dead in your room? Didn’t I ask you if you are in any trouble?" (innkeeper)
"It’s not like we know why these guys are attacking us in the middle of the night! Maybe they saw us yesterday on the market, where we paid quite a sum and got the wrong ideas." (Shari)
For a moment I considered to tell her about the problem with Cid, to get some information regarding the darker side of this town, as she seems well informed.
Yet, after giving it some thought I assumed that we would then have to look for another inn the next day, as she is rather keen to avoid trouble.

"So you say they just wanted to rob you?" (innkeeper)
"That could be. I mean we have quite a sum of silver with us." (Shari)
"Are you dumb?! Voicing something like this here!" (innkeeper)
"Sorry, my mistake." (Shari)
I doubt that someone would directly want to follow the corpses, but maybe my attempt to pretend to be just an innocent girl was a bit too much.
"Urgh! I have no nerve for this. I need to go now to the guard! Keep yourself covered and raise no further commotions." (innkeeper)
There is not much to do now, so we head back to our room, as despite the corpses all our stuff is in there.
I need again to ingrain into Liqu that she is not allowed to devour the corpses, much to her dismay.
We enter our room and find the cloaked figure from before.
"Hm, clean cut. One fast slice. And the other… Interesting! Perfectly aimed. A very thin blade. Didn’t get stuck in the eyehole. Looks quite professional." (?)
Okay, I’ve got three different kinds of mental goosebumps, which I quickly need to get rid of, before they become actual ones and ripple my body.
First, how did I not notice her leaving her room and entering ours?
Yes, the voice sounds female.
Second, anyone who looks at a wound and can deduct that it looks professional has spent too much thought on the matter of cutting people.
And my third reason for goosebumps, the fact that she is this perceptive makes me anxious where she will aim that ability of hers next.
You know which issue I have in mind.
"Excuse us, but what are you doing in our room? Even rented it stays our privacy!" (Shari)
"I just looked at the work of an assassin I didn’t know. Who of you was it?" (?)
I am getting sized by poisonous yellow-green eyes, which are all that is visible, yet enough to become unnerved.
"That’s none of your business! Please go now!" (Shari)
"I tend towards you. The other one gives less of a sharp atmosphere. Dangerous yes, but she doesn’t look like blades. At least not like the type who uses them effectively. More like someone who enjoys it to play with her victims. Am I right?" (?)
"Yes, kinda." (Liqu)
"Liqu! Shut up!"
"Do you have a target in town? Do I know it?" (?)

"OUT! NOW!" (Shari)
That talk goes completely wrong!
After all, I’ve been through, for sure I won’t join the assassin’s guild and this looks far too much like an interview!
But fortunately, she leaves without another word.
Creepy!
And that’s coming from a flesh-devouring slime.
Duh, I really need to stop going against myself with my references.
But really, she was wrong.
I’m for sure no assassin.
It’s not like I can do much about the fact that this body can’t have any slips in usage.
And I felt very bad after the killing, yet I have my puke avoidance training and I am not able to feel physically sick.
It’s not my fault that I can murder people like a professional!
After some time the guard is entering.
All heavily armed people in tight armor.
I can see our innkeeper talk to someone I assume to be the boss of them.
"Gareth, I just for you came to report this, so please don’t make too much of a fuss in my inn." (innkeeper)
"Marsha, we both know that doing anything different than calling us would mean contributing to a crime, and like this leading to your imprisonment." (Gareth)
"It wasn’t even a crime! They died while they tried to rob us. So the killing was in accordance with the law." (innkeeper/Marsha)
"That is my job to decide. Stay back!" (Gareth)
"No reason to go full guard captain on me." (Marsha)
Eventually, he spots us.
Not much to do about this as my plan was to talk me out of this situation.
"So who are you to get in this kind of situation?" (Gareth)
"My name is Shari and this is Liqu. We just came yesterday into this town and promptly get attacked during our second night." (Shari)
"However, it seems you retaliated, and this rather hard." (Gareth)
"It’s not like we could just ask them nicely to leave." (Shari)
"You should watch your mouth, girl. You could offend the wrong people." (Gareth)
Like the local gangster boss?
"They just came in and we defended our lives! I just got lucky with my dagger!" (Shari)
"My reports are supporting your claim, but I need to investigate thoroughly. By the way, what can you tell me what happened?" (Gareth)
Oh no! Why he had to ask Liqu? Why?
"Wait you are asking me?" (Liqu)
"Yes, who else? You were there, so tell me your opinion." (Gareth)
"Yes, yes, okay! Those men came into our room! I was so scared! I don’t know what to do! This all is too much for me!" (Liqu)
It’s over!
Yes, I said she shall show more feel with her answer.
But from all the ways how she could have said that.
Even her monotonous speech.
She chooses to be cheery while giving that gleeful smile!
And stop looking this expectant at me, waiting for confirmation!
This scrutinizing gaze he has now can mean absolutely everything but nothing good for us.
I never imagined that it is possible to furrow your brow this much.
"Fine. We are done then. Just go to that guard there and make your testimony. You both are no known criminals, while the dead ones are. So there is not much I can do against your… suspicious demeanor." (Gareth)
That wasn’t even dodged, stupid slime!
Liqu! Learn about emotions! Stupid!
It takes some time and I need to show my dagger for confirmation.
As everything looks like self-defense and we have nothing illicit in our room, after a while, the guards are departing.
A body examination was apparently not necessary, as there were no indications for us having anything to do with smuggling.
And maybe I threw Jacob in front of me, as a bailsman, when I gave my testimony.
The upcoming peace is fine, as the stress was hard on me.
Well, it's not like I could break out in a sweat.
So I can close the door and relax a bit.
The only one who stays agitated is Liqu.
"Wait! You killed them and they let you go? Just like this? No one goes after you?" (Liqu)
"It is okay. We have done nothing wrong. They attacked us first and we only defended. So there is nothing to blame us for and we can just leave." (Shari)
"That was so often the case, but they always blamed me!" (Liqu)
I have the feeling that life was unfair to Liqu before in these matters.
"That’s what the disguise is for." (Shari)
"Still, this is unfair!" (Liqu)
"You don’t need to like it. Just know that both of us benefit when we won’t get discovered. Fine?" (Shari)
"Fine. You know better, how to interact with them." (Liqu)
One of her good points is that she is receptive to listen to me.
I appreciate this.
